Jayco Bay Cycling Classic

Jayco Bay Cycling Classic
Stage 1- Eastern Gardens
The team of Bec, Sarah, Chloe, and guest riders Miffy Galloway and Chloe Hoskings rode well. The aim was to set up Chloe Hoskings for the sprint. An attack at 3 to go meant that Chloe McConville burnt up all her lead out legs chasing it back and it was left up to the other remaining girls to help out. Not all went exactly to plan with Chloe Hoskings finishing just out of the top 10, but some positive aspects were taken out of the race.







Stage 2- Portarlington
By far the toughest circuit of the Bay Crits, an early crash took out some big names, with Belinda Goss breaking her collarbone and our rider Chloe Hoskings coming off and snapping her brand new team bike. The tough circuit took its toll and only 15 or girls finishing the stage. Unfortunatley none of our girls finished. The stage win was taken out by Tiffany Cromwell in a solo break.





Stage 3- Ritchie Boulevard
The hot-dog circuit is one renowned for crashes and some really tough racing. Definitely the best result of the racing for us so far with Bec finishing not far out of the top ten and Chloe Hoskings bagging a 2nd in a sprint finish. The win was taken out by Rochelle Gilmore (Honda Dream Team). A big thanks has to go to Paul Beretta for sourcing a new specialized bike for Chloe to race on.







Stage 4- Williamstown
Last stage = some tired legs and some girls who really wanted to keep The Honda Dream Team from a clean sweep. Racing again was fast paced with the Jayco team throwing down everything to make the Honda girls tired. Chloe Hoskings again did the team proud with a 3rd place behind fellow HTC highroad team mate Judith Arndt and Rochelle Gilmore.





Overall:
Chloe Hoskings 5th place GC
